A man wearing an M&M’s T-shirt that says “Surrounded by Nuts” was busted at the Port Authority on Monday night for pointing a loaded gun at another guy during an argument, sources said.

Christopher Wood, 21, of Cleveland, took a gun out of his luggage around 9 p.m. and pressed it up against the chest of another man during an argument, witnesses told cops.

Port Authority Police Officers Philip Tysowski and Lenny Guzman were summoned to the scene and spotted a man matching the witness’ description — Wood — and began to question him.

Wood acted nervously, but agreed to accompany cops to an area where he could be questioned further.

He initially denied having any gun, but after granting officers the right to search his bag, cops spotted a stolen 9mm pistol with a defaced serial number.

The weapon, sources said, had an illegal hollow-point bullet in the chamber and three more in the magazine.

Wood declared, “I’m not a violent person. It’s for protection!”

Cops found Wood’s T-shirt humorous.

“The public doesn’t really appreciate what we see on a daily basis. This gets filed under the category of, ‘You can’t make this up!'” said a police official.

Wood was booked for illegal weapon possession and was awaiting arraignment early today.
